Visiting Chestertown, MD


With a colonial history dating back to the 17th century, Chestertown, Maryland is proud of its maritime heritage. Sitting on the banks of the Chester River, sailing ships can still be seen coming into port. The city is the home of the Schooner Sultana, an exact replica of an 18th century ship that served in the British Royal Navy, now operating as an educational vessel. Every Memorial Day, the city hosts The Chestertown Tea Party Festival, proudly tossing the British overboard annually.
